... Ski Deals is located at 2525 Arapahoe Avenue, and Colorado Ski & Sports is at 8691 Park Meadows Center Drive in Lone Tree. What you'll find there are brand name skis, snowboards, clothing, helmets and accessories from last season's inventory priced ...
↧